Salt and Pepper Prawns with Lime and Chilli Dipping Sauce

Crispy, golden perfection meets zesty, spicy flavor in this recipe for Salt and Pepper Prawns with Lime and Chilli Dipping Sauce. Succulent prawns are coated in a delicate blend of cornstarch, flour, and aromatic spices, then fried to a satisfying crunch. The bold seasoning with black and white pepper adds a kick of heat, while the tangy dipping sauce—featuring fresh lime juice, soy sauce, and honey—perfectly balances sweetness and spice. Topped with vibrant red chilli slices and served with lime wedges, these prawns are ideal for everything from party appetizers to indulgent weeknight dinners. Prep Time:20 mins
Cook Time:10 mins
Total Time:30 mins
Servings: 4

Ingredients

  • 500 g Raw prawns (peeled and deveined, tails on)
  • 100 g Cornstarch
  • 50 g All-purpose flour
  • 2 tsp Salt
  • 1 tsp Black pepper (freshly ground)
  • 1 tsp White pepper
  • 1 tsp Garlic powder
  • 500 ml Vegetable oil (for frying)
  • 1 Red chilli (thinly sliced)
  • 2 tbsp Fresh lime juice
  • 1 tbsp Soy sauce
  • 1 tsp Honey
  • 1 tbsp Fresh coriander leaves (chopped)
  • 4 Lime wedges (for garnish)

Directions

Step 1

Prepare the prawns by rinsing them under cold water and patting them dry with paper towels. Set aside.

Step 2

In a mixing bowl, combine cornstarch, all-purpose flour, 1 teaspoon of salt, black pepper, white pepper, and garlic powder. Mix well.

Step 3

Heat the vegetable oil in a deep frying pan or wok over medium-high heat until it reaches approximately 180°C (350°F). To check, drop a small piece of batter into the oil—if it sizzles and rises to the surface, the oil is ready.

Step 4

Dredge the prawns in the dry flour mixture, ensuring each is fully coated. Shake off any excess flour.

Step 5

Carefully lower a batch of prawns (5-7 at a time) into the hot oil and fry for 2-3 minutes or until they are golden and crispy. Remove with a slotted spoon and place on a plate lined with paper towels to drain any excess oil. Repeat with the remaining prawns.

Step 6

To make the lime and chilli dipping sauce, combine lime juice, soy sauce, honey, and half the sliced red chilli in a small bowl. Stir until evenly mixed. Garnish with fresh coriander leaves.

Step 7

Arrange the crispy prawns on a serving platter and sprinkle with the remaining sliced red chilli and 1 teaspoon of salt.

Step 8

Serve immediately with the lime and chilli dipping sauce on the side, along with lime wedges for squeezing over the prawns.
